    Not sure , but I think this about that .....
    some of those "hump" back crappie we see from time to time might be ......
    caused by genetics ,rather than some of the other reasons I have read that cause it .
    Case in point , one location I hit from time to time produces many more of them than any other spot I know of . That coupled with the fact that they are in a private lake tends to make me think someone been tossing back the ugly ones and keeping the pretty ones , thus causing the malformation to be enhanced in numbers , just saying.
    Out of 20 or so I ketched at lunch time on "hump day" about 4 or so at high noon were in that category of the severe spinal curvature range.
    always wondered what caused it and am beginning to think it is mostly genetics.
